Key Features and Functionalities
Five9 provides a robust set of features aimed at enhancing customer engagement. The software includes:
- Automatic Call Distribution (ACD): This feature prioritizes and routes incoming calls based on preset rules, improving response times.
- Interactive Voice Response (IVR): Customers can interact with a database through the phone, allowing self-service options that free up agent resources.
- Omni-Channel Support: Allows customers to engage through their preferred channels without losing context of their interactions.
- CRM Integration: Seamlessly integrates with popular customer relationship management systems, ensuring data consistency across platforms.
- Analytics and Reporting Tools: Provides insights into performance metrics, helping businesses to identify areas for improvement.
These functionalities work together to create an environment conducive to effective communication, essential for retaining customers in today’s competitive market.

History and Evolution
The evolution of Five9 is marked by its adaptation to the changing landscape of technology and customer expectations. Founded in 2001, the company set out with the vision of transforming how contact centers operate. Initially, Five9 offered traditional call center services. Over time, it recognized the shift towards cloud technology and the need for integrated communication solutions. This responsiveness to market demands enabled Five9 to innovate continually, introducing new features such as artificial intelligence and omnichannel capabilities, thus keeping its services relevant in a competitive market.

Automatic Call Distribution
Automatic Call Distribution (ACD) is a critical feature that ensures calls are efficiently directed to the most appropriate agents. This system minimizes wait times and optimizes the customer experience. ACD’s algorithms can analyze various parameters, such as the caller's needs and agent availability.
The benefits of ACD include:
- Reduced Customer Wait Times: Efficient routing leads to quicker responses.
- Increased Agent Productivity: Agents spend less time managing calls and more time addressing customer concerns.
- Data-Driven Decisions: Reports generated by ACD help managers understand call patterns and agent performance.
Adopting ACD can improve the overall effectiveness of a contact center, making it a vital feature of Five9 software.
Interactive Voice Response (IVR)


Interactive Voice Response (IVR) systems allow callers to navigate phone menus using voice commands or keypad inputs. This feature significantly enhances user experience by providing self-service options. Customers can access information or direct their calls without needing to speak to an agent, reducing the workload for human resources.
The significance of IVR includes:
- 24/7 Availability: Customers can receive assistance outside business hours.
- Customized Experience: Tailored menus can cater to specific customer needs based on their profiles.
- Data Collection: IVR systems gather valuable data on customer interactions, which can be analyzed for improving services.
Implementing IVR not only improves efficiency but also increases customer satisfaction levels.

Cost-Effectiveness Compared to Traditional Solutions
Adopting Five9 can lead to considerable cost savings compared to traditional on-premises solutions. With a cloud-based infrastructure, companies avoid hefty upfront costs related to hardware and maintenance. Five9 operates on a subscription model, which offers flexibility and scalability for businesses as they grow. Organizations can select plans according to their specific needs without purchasing unnecessary features.
Moreover, operational costs related to staffing can also see improvement. Five9 enables remote work capabilities, reducing the need for physical office space and related expenses. As a result, many organizations find the transition to Five9 helps streamline their budget allocations while maintaining or even enhancing service levels.

Common CRM Integrations
Five9 offers compatibility with several prominent Customer Relationship Management (CRM) systems. This integration is crucial. By connecting Five9 with CRMs like Salesforce, HubSpot, or Zendesk, companies can ensure that customer interactions are logged, tracked, and analyzed effectively. This not only enhances the user experience but also provides teams with relevant insights about customer history and preferences.
The benefits of such integrations include:
- Streamlined Processes: Automation reduces the need for manual entry of customer data, allowing agents to focus on interactions.
- Holistic View of Customer Data: Access to comprehensive customer information leads to informed decision-making in real time.
- Improved Analytics: Integrated platforms create deeper insights through combined data analysis, allowing for targeted marketing and service improvements.

Overview of Key Competitors
Five9 operates in a space with notable competitors. Some key players include:
- RingCentral: Known for its robust cloud communications services, RingCentral also offers strong contact center solutions, making it a significant rival for Five9.
- Genesys Cloud: This platform emphasizes customer experience, integrating AI capabilities to enhance interactions across various channels.
- NICE inContact: Recognized for its comprehensive cloud contact center solutions. NICE inContact focuses heavily on analytics and customer service.
- Avaya: Although traditionally known for on-premise solutions, Avaya has adjusted its strategy with a cloud-based offering.
Each of these companies has its strengths and weaknesses. For example, RingCentral excels in unified communications, while Genesys is lauded for its experience and AI capabilities.

Potential Drawbacks of Five9
Five9, like any software solution, is not without its drawbacks. A few notable points include:
- Internet Dependence: Being a cloud-based solution, Five9 relies heavily on a stable and fast internet connection. Any disruptions can impair service and lead to customer dissatisfaction.
- Pricing Structure: The cost of implementation and ongoing usage can be substantial. Particularly for smaller businesses, this may pose a budgetary challenge.
- Learning Curve: For new users or organizations transitioning from traditional systems, there may be a steep learning curve. Users may need significant training to become proficient with the platform.
- Occasional Technical Issues: Users have mentioned experiencing technical glitches on occasion. Such issues can disrupt operations and cause frustration among team members.
These drawbacks warrant careful consideration, especially for organizations thriving on operational continuity and customer satisfaction.
